Yes, the TLB package has a backhoe that attaches to a subframe that is mounted to the rear and under the tractor that stays on the tractor full time (it is also part of the 4 post ROPS system). The backhoe itself is attached at 4 points. The backhoe is locked and released from the back of the tractor by a single lever action. The drivers seat tilts forward and the backhoe seat drops back into the same space, so you are working under the ROPS and FOPS structure while using the hoe. Thie make a very short overhang on the back which makes it easier to load and unload on trailer ramps and to drive upon uneven terrain. this is a rugged little TLB. The way the backhoe mounts on the LK3054XS TLB package it sits closer to the tractor. Because of this you cannot use your three point hitch arms, or your three point hitch at all. The subframe unit that comes on the LK3054XS TLB is super stout...the strongest I have ever seen on a unit, overkill in my opinion but it sure is stout. So on the dedicated TLB package it is just that, dedicated, no 3-point hitch. Because of this the backhoe sits closer to the tractor meaning less overhang which equals better clearance.

The front end loader on the LK3054XS is a "front push" model, also known as a front mount. All CK & DK series (and almost all other modern tractors, besides Mahindra) have "mid-mount" loaders. This is just due to the LK's older design, same thing on the LB1914.
